What if a man who wrote nothing became the foundation of Western philosophy?
The Complete Socrates Collection is the ultimate anthology of works capturing the life, thought, and paradox of history’s most enigmatic philosopher. This modern edition unites the classic writings of Plato, Xenophon, and Aristophanes—each offering a distinct window into the mind and mission of Socrates.
Spanning high philosophy, personal testimony, and comic satire, this collection presents Socrates as teacher, martyr, gadfly, and mystery. These timeless dialogues invite you into the heart of Socratic inquiry—asking what it means to live wisely, justly, and well.
What You’ll Discover:
- The Republic – Plato’s profound vision of justice, the ideal state, and the philosopher-king.
- Apology, Crito, Phaedo – The gripping trial, defiant defense, and final moments of Socrates.
- Symposium & The Clouds – Plato’s exaltation of love and Aristophanes’ comedic critique of Socratic absurdity.
- Memorabilia & Oeconomicus – Xenophon’s personal accounts of Socrates’ daily wisdom and moral teachings.
- Apology by Xenophon – A stark and practical contrast to Plato’s philosophical version.
- All His Classic Works – Presented in clear, faithful translations for both newcomers and seasoned listeners.
